CurveBeam AI achieves increased purchase orders for first quarter of FY24
Medical imaging equipment provider CurveBeam AI (ASX: CVB) has achieved a key metric of increased purchase order sales for the first quarter of the 2024 financial year. The company received four purchase orders for its flagship HiRise scanner device in the period ending 30 September, representing a 100% increase on the same time last year […]

CurveBeam AI reveals strong revenue growth in maiden annual report
Specialised medical imaging scanner developer CurveBeam AI (ASX: CVB) has confirmed a significant period of activities in its maiden annual report. The company listed on the ASX in late August following a well-supported $25 million initial public offering. CurveBeam AI makes ASX debut, reports $11.48m full-year revenue
Point-of-care specialised medical imaging supplier CurveBeam AI (ASX: CVB) has made its Australian Stock Exchange debut following a $25 million initial public offering. CurveBeam AI launches $25m IPO to advance global medical imaging opportunities
Medical imaging technologies developer CurveBeam AI is set to list on the Australian Securities Exchange as part of a $25 million initial public offering.
